Can You Perform a Patent Search on Your Own?

While free tools like Google Patents or Espacenet can help with an initial review, they lack advanced search capabilities, filtering options, and access to international databases. Many low-cost or automated services may not provide a comprehensive search, missing crucial prior art that could affect your patent’s success.

A professional patent search goes beyond basic keyword searches. At Patentarea, we use industry-leading search tools to analyze patents across over 100 jurisdictions, ensuring you receive the most comprehensive and reliable results.

Is a Patent Search Mandatory?

No, but it is highly recommended. A patent application requires a significant investment, and conducting a search beforehand can save time and money by identifying potential obstacles early. The cost of a professional search is minimal compared to the expense of drafting, filing, and prosecuting a patent application.
